How long until incisions completely healed?

I have had an anchor lift and implants on July 8. The incisions are freaking me out a bit. i was wondering how long until they are completely healed and i don't have to worry about infection or stitches coming loose?

Hi! I had areola incisions (Benelli lift), and you'll find there are different stages. Mine were closed within a week or so. Around Week 2 I had scabs and they started to fall off. I'm in Week 6 and I can barely see the incisions anymore! It's hard to even tell where they were.

I don't have any incisions on the breast itself, just the areola, so maybe someone can help you with that part.

Be patient - you will be surprised how rapidly you start to heal once you get thru the first couple of weeks.

My doc also said to be very careful of any sun exposure, as that can cause scars to permanently darken.

Good luck with your healing!

I think mine were completely closed around week 4. Mine took extra time because I had an infection in the incision also right now I have a stitch hanging out so I still have to be careful

I am at 2 weeks and 1 day, my external stitches are out and the steri-strips are off. Most of both incisions are completely closed up, however, there are still a couple spots on both that are, not really open, but would have scabs on if I didn't still use Bacitricin and bandages.
